ASP.NET working with MS Word??

Hello,

I'd like to use Microsoft Word in an ASP.NET application. I've referenced to
MS Word, but when the sourcecode-line 'Dim objWord As New Word.Application'
is reached, I an exception is thrown. The exception message is as follows:

Exception Details: System.UnauthorizedAccessException: Access denied. The
ASP.NET process is not authorized to access the requested resource. For
security reasons the default ASP.NET process identity is
'{machinename}\ASPNET', which has limited privileges. Consider granting
access rights to the resource to the ASP.NET process identity. To grant
ASP.NET write access to a file, right-click the file in Explorer, choose
"Properties" and select the Security tab. Click "Add" to add the
"{machinename}\ASPNET" user. Highlight the ASP.NET account, and check the
Write box in the Allow column. The exception message already describes some
sort of solution, but I don't really get what to do to solve this problem.
Can anyone help me with this?
